Debt Collection letter - TALK TALK - BW legal - never had an account

Hi i've received a letter from BW legal and JC international claiming I owe £92.05. This is the first I've ever heard of it and not sure how they have my details....

I nearly took out a talk talk broadband, did a quote etc, but didn't complete the purchase - I have the email to say not completed... 
Now they are claiming money despite me never having opened an account or started the service...

BW legal are asking for date of birth and other personal info to talk to me. I don't want to supply this as I don't trust them.

What should I do?

    Either ignore it, or send them a prove it letter. Legally they are obliged to provide proof that you owe the debt - it's not up to you to prove that you don't owe it. When they can't, they should cease enforcement action.
